Overview

Postcode S65 2DZ is located in a minor urban area, within the Boston Castle ward of Rotherham in the Yorkshire and The Humber region, and forms part of the Eastwood & East Dene area. It has very high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 134.0 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Eastwood & East Dene is £37,457 per year. The nearest station is Rotherham Central located about 0.8 miles away. There are 9 primary and 3 secondary schools in the area. There are 1 parks nearby, closest large park is Clifton Park.

Property prices in Boston Castle

Based on 114 recent sales, the median property price is £181,250 in Boston Castle area, with individual transactions ranging from £36,250 up to £665,000.
